Ingredients
List of Ingredients
To make your Crunchy Almond Chocolate Chip Biscotti, gather these simple items:
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/3 cup unsalted butter, melted and slightly cooled
- 2 large eggs, at room temperature
- 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
- 1/4 teaspoon almond extract
- 1/2 cup almonds, roughly chopped
- 1/2 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ips

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paration and Preheating
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). This step is key for even baking.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. This will help the biscotti not stick.
Mixing Dry Ingredients
In a large bowl, mix the dry ingredients. Combine 2 cups of flour, 1 cup of sugar, 1/2 teaspoon of baking powder, 1/2 teaspoon of baking soda, and 1/4 teaspoon of salt. Whisk these together until they blend well. This ensures an even rise.
Combining Wet Ingredients
In another bowl, whisk the wet ingredients. Combine 1/3 cup of melted butter, 2 large eggs, 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ract, and 1/4 teaspoon of almond extract. Mix until smooth. This mixture adds flavor and moisture to the biscotti.
Shaping the Dough
Dust a clean surface with flour. Transfer the dough onto the surface. Shape it into a log about 12 inches long and 3 inches wide. Flatten the top slightly. This helps the dough bake evenly.
Baking Twice for Perfect Crunch
Place the log on the lined baking sheet. Bake for 25-30 minutes until golden brown. After cooling for 10 minutes, slice the log into 1/2-inch thick pieces. Arrange the slices cut side down on the baking sheet. Bake them again for 10-15 minutes, flipping halfway. This double bake makes the biscotti crunchy and delicious.
Tips & Tricks
Achieving the Perfect Biscotti Texture
To get the right crunch in your biscotti, follow these steps:
- Mix the dough until just combined. Overmixing makes it tough.
- Shape the log with a flat top. This helps it bake evenly.
- Slice the log while it is warm. Warm dough cuts easily.
When baking the second time, adjust the time based on your oven. Every oven runs a bit different. Keep an eye on the biscotti to avoid burning.
Recommended Baking Techniques
Use these tips to bake your biscotti perfectly:
- Always preheat your oven before baking. This ensures even cooking.
- Use parchment paper on your baking sheet. It keeps the biscotti from sticking.
- Flip the slices halfway through the second bake to brown both sides.
Consider using a serrated knife for slicing. It cuts through the hard edges smoothly.
Storing for Maximum Freshness
To keep your biscotti fresh:
- Store them in an airtight container. This helps keep them crunchy.
- Place a paper towel in the container to absorb moisture.
- For longer storage, freeze them in a zip-top bag.
Thaw them at room temperature when you're ready to enjoy. This keeps their crunch intact.

Storage Info
Best Practices for Storing Biscotti
To keep your crunchy almond chocolate chip biscotti fresh, store them in an airtight container. This protects them from moisture and air. Place parchment paper between layers of biscotti to prevent sticking. It also helps maintain their crunch. Store the container in a cool, dry place away from sunlight. This method preserves flavor and texture.
Freezing Instructions for Longer Shelf Life
If you want to save biscotti for later, freezing works great. Cool the biscotti completely after baking. Wrap each piece in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e bag. Label the bag with the date. This keeps them fresh for up to three months. When you want to enjoy them, thaw at room temperature. You can also re-crisp them in the oven for a few minutes.
Shelf Life of Biscotti
Homemade biscotti can last about two weeks at room temperature in an airtight container. If you freeze them, they last much longer. Just be sure to check for any signs of freezer burn before using.
